Dr. Dan Callahan honored with 2021 Senator Sam Nunn Community Leadership Award

Dr. Dan Callahan was presented posthumously the Senator Sam Nunn Community Leadership Award for 2021 at Robins Air Force Base, Georgia, Feb. 23. His son, Dr. Daniel Callahan, accepted the award from Col. Lindsay Droz, Installation and 78th Air Base Wing commander. This is a prestigious honor given annually to someone in the community whose actions are consistently above and beyond in support of the installation and the United States Air Force.

“Over eight long decades, the people serving at this base have been the lifeblood of our critical missions for the nation, and the local community has been the heart of Robins Air Force Base,” said Col. Droz. “This year’s award recipient embodies that long-standing and unparalleled support.”

In 1968, Dr. Callahan coined the phrase “Every Day in Middle Georgia is Air Force Appreciation Day,” and in 2004 it was changed to Armed Forces to salute all our men and women in uniform. After 54 years, this mantra stands strong and true. Every Day in Middle Georgia is Armed Forces Appreciation Day – EDIMGIAFAD – demonstrates the long-standing community–base partnership.

In a video message Nunn stated, “The spirit of appreciation that came from this expression really caught on and was prescribed by Dr. Callahan and became contagious. It helped to build a trusted relationship, which exists to this day with Robins Air Force Base and the community.”
